An Asian Journal of Soil Science, Vol 7, No 2 (2012), Pagination: 239-241Abstract
Experiment was conducted for the summer season of 2009 at the College Agronomy Farm, B.A. College of Agriculture, Anand Gujarat in order to find out the effect of phosphorus and sulphur on cluster bean, three levels of phosphorus and sulphur (0, 20 and 40 kg P2O5 and S ha-1) were applied. The yield of cluster bean (beed and stover) and nutrient uptake were influenced by the rate of phosphorus and sulphur. Application of 40 kg P2O5 and S ha-1 gave significantly higher yield and nutrient uptake (N, P, K and S) by cluster bean.Keywords

An Asian Journal of Soil Science, Vol 7, No 2 (2012), Pagination: 249-252Abstract
Nine treatments comprised of three levels of phosphorus (P0, P1 and P2) and Sulphur (S0, S1 and S2) were tested in Factorial Randomized Block Design with four replications in field experiment conducted during summer season 2009-10. phosphorus and sulphur were applied @ 20 kg ha-1 and 40 kg ha-1 as DAP and gypsum, respectively. Initial available phosphorus was medium whereas an S content was low in the soil. Yield and quality parameter of cluster bean were increased by the treatments P2 and S2 over control. The study of nutrient content of seed revealed that application 40 kg ha-1 of either phosphorus or sulphur treatments favourably influenced in comparison to their respective control. The nutrient status of soil after harvest crop was also shown highest at the rate of 40 kg ha-1 either phosphorus or sulphur.Keywords
